Local Family Honors Their Son’s Memory with Scholarship Fund for CFCC Culinary Art Students

Foundation receives scholarship check

Logan Thompson, Executive Director of the CFCC Foundation (left), and Bernard Brunson, Darius Brunson’s father (right)

Wilmington, NC – The Brunson Family has come together to create a lasting legacy in memory of their son, Darius Robert Brunson, who lost his battle with leukemia in December of 2022. To celebrate their son’s passion for the culinary arts and give back to the community and school that he loved, the family created the Darius R. Brunson Memorial Scholarship fund.

Through various fundraisers, including a community yard sale, Darius’ family and friends have raised over $10,000 to help aspiring chefs fulfill their dreams. A scholarship of $500 will be awarded to two Cape Fear Community College Culinary Arts students each academic year. Eligible students must be enrolled in one of CFCC’s Culinary Arts programs and have a GPA of 2.5 or higher.

“Some people enter our lives for a second or a short period, and that’s OK,” said Bernard Brunson. “Then there are those who come into your life for a lifetime, whose legacy will always live on, and that is our Darius. I always taught him to focus on the people that are there for the good, bad, and the ugly, the ones that are always there for you. We started the Darius R. Brunson Memorial Scholarship to continue our son’s legacy and be there for students pursuing his passion of cooking.”

“The Cape Fear Community College Foundation is grateful for the generosity of the Brunson Family,” said Logan Thompson, Executive Director, CFCC Foundation. “Their decision to establish a scholarship fund for Culinary Arts students will aid in breaking down barriers for their students in their pursuit of culinary excellence, something that was deeply important to their son. This scholarship will ensure that his memory lives in the kitchens and hearts of those who share his love for food.”
